摘要
Although capacitive pressure sensors have been widely used in tactile sensing, human-computer interface, and medical applications, the viscoelastic and incompressible characteristics of the dielectric layer continue to be the primary limiting factors for achieving high sensitivity and fast response times. In this study, we propose a new flexible capacitive pressure sensor (FCPS), with a bionic honeycomb structure as a dielectric layer structure via 3-D printing and optimize its architecture through finite element simulation. Aluminum oxide (Al $_{\text{2}}$ O $_{\text{3}}$ ) nanoparticles with a high dielectric constant were chosen to be doped into the PDMS to form the dielectric layer. Owing to the optimized bionic honeycomb structure and the incorporation of high-dielectric material, the PDMS/Al $_{\text{2}}$ O $_{\text{3}}$ -based flexible capacitive pressure sensor (PAFPS) exhibits high sensitivity ( $\sim$ 1.75 kPa $^{-\text{1}}$ in the range of 0–1 kPa and 0.045 kPa $^{-\text{1}}$ in the range of 1–200 kPa) and rapid response time ( $\sim$ 37.5 ms), which represents a significant improvement compared to previous reports. Furthermore, the successful application of PAFPS in various scenarios has provided valuable insights for the advancement of next-generation wearable electronic devices.
